> With an RDBMS datastore, when generating the schema, it is desirable to be
> able to specify the positioning of the column(s) of a field in the generated
> table.
> With spreadsheet documents, it is critical to be able to define which column
> number is used for a particular field.
> With other datastores it is also likely desirable.
> To achieve this I propose adding an attribute to the XML <column> called
> "position". Similarly for the @Column annotation.
> This can take integer values with 0-origin.
> Complications :
> 1. how this is handled when we have inheritance. If a root class has
> subclass-table inheritance, then those fields are persisted into the tables
> of all subclasses, and we may want to override the positions for those
> individually - to that end the user can override the metadata of the
> superclass fields.
